Understanding the Fahrenheit and Celsius Scales



Before diving into the conversion, it's vital to understand the fundamental differences between Fahrenheit and Celsius. Both are temperature scales, but they employ different reference points. The Fahrenheit scale, invented by Daniel Gabriel Fahrenheit, uses the freezing point of a brine solution (a mixture of water and salt) as 0°F and the average human body temperature as 98.6°F. Celsius, developed by Anders Celsius, uses the freezing point of water as 0°C and the boiling point of water as 100°C at standard atmospheric pressure. This makes Celsius a more intuitive and scientifically consistent scale.


The Conversion Formula: From Fahrenheit to Celsius



Converting between Fahrenheit (°F) and Celsius (°C) requires a simple, yet crucial, formula:

°C = (°F - 32) × 5/9

Applying this to our target temperature of 93.8°F:

°C = (93.8 - 32) × 5/9 = 61.8 × 5/9 ≈ 34.33°C

Therefore, 93.8°F is approximately equivalent to 34.33°C. This seemingly small difference can have significant implications depending on the context.

Common Pitfalls and Avoiding Errors



While the conversion formula is straightforward, several common pitfalls can lead to inaccuracies:

Order of Operations: Remember to subtract 32 from the Fahrenheit temperature before multiplying by 5/9. Incorrect order of operations is a frequent source of errors.

Rounding Errors: Rounding off intermediate results can accumulate errors, especially in critical applications. It's advisable to use the full decimal value throughout the calculation.

Unit Consistency: Always double-check that you're using the correct units (°F and °C). Confusing Fahrenheit and Celsius can lead to catastrophic consequences in certain contexts.
